Police expand search area for three fishermen missing off Cairns since last Tuesday

Police searching for three fishermen missing in seas off Cairns in Far North Queensland since Australia Day are expanding the search to cover tens of thousands of square kilometres, but say hopes of finding them alive are diminishing.
Key points:
- Searchers last week found a waterlogged lifejacket and two fuel containers from the missing boat
- Police had since received an unconfirmed report of another fuel container found within the search area
- The search is focussing on islands in the area to rule out if the men are stranded and unable to call for help
The three men — aged 18, 27 and 37 — were last seen off the coast of Green Island on Tuesday.
A large-scale air and sea search was sparked when they failed to return home that evening.
